Works well. A lot more difficult to use than say senuke x and magicsubmitter.

I might stick with magic I think they are are around the same price.

With sick though you can make your own packets and add sites unlike most other programs.
Longer learning curve. But if you like to be more hands on and techie than this is the program for you. The ability to customize beats out all the other programs.

But you are trading of ease of use to set up. Once set up though it rocks like a pro.
 
If you have some basic programming(html, php, regex) knowledge go for sick submitter, and even if you don't have, you'll find platform packets on their forum(free or paid); it has the lowest price on the market(around $19+/monthly but there are some coupons I think) and also you'll start to love it's community and support. It's tricky to accommodate with the interface but that's only at beginning(from a couple of hours to a couple of days). If you master Sick Submitter there is no need for other expensive software...but you will have to add your own websites to make the difference :)

I used Sick Submitted for a few months, it's not bad. It doesn't fully do what SenukeX, but for the price you really can't beat it. It's definitely worth a shot to test out.
 
I am running a packet in Sick Submitter of 1500 pligg bookmarking sites. It creates the profile then submits the bookmark then even comments on the bookmark and then outputs the url of the bookmark so I can ping it or do whatever I want to do with it.

This is just one of the MANY features of sick submitter. Also with sick submitter 4 coming out (it is in beta) the new browser makes it even easier for a noob to make their own packets.
